- Paper, thin-layer, and classical column chromatography techniques, as well as high-performance liquid chromatography (HPLC) and ion chromatography, all belong to the class of liquid chromatography. (edu.au)
- High-performance liquid chromatography or HPLC is a form of column chromatography that is most frequently used in analytical chemistry . (extraktlab.com)
- The name "high-performance" and "high-pressure" are often used interchangeably because of the relatively high pressures used in HPLC chromatography systems. (extraktlab.com)

- The silica gel is the stationary phase, TLC uses a thin uniform layer of silica gel or alumina coated onto a piece of glass, metal or rigid plastic. (majortests.com)
- Two types are gas-solid chromatography, where the fixed phase is a solid, and gas-liquid, in which the stationary phase is a nonvolatile liquid supported on an inert solid matrix. (lookformedical.com)

- Liquid chromatography is a broad classification used to describe a variety of different chromatographic configurations that rely on the use of a liquid mobile phase. (edu.au)
